Foundation leak repair services focus on identifying and fixing water intrusion issues that originate from or affect the foundation of a property. Over time, cracks, holes, or structural weaknesses can develop in the foundation due to settling, shifting, or exposure to moisture.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ques to locate the source of leaks, which may involve inspecting crawl spaces, basements, or exterior walls. Once the problem is diagnosed, they can implement solutions such as sealing cracks, installing drainage systems, or applying waterproof coatings to prevent further water entry and protect the integrity of the foundation.
These services are essential for addressing a variety of common problems caused by foundation leaks. Excess moisture can lead to mold growth, wood rot, and damage to interior walls and flooring. In some cases, water infiltration can cause soil erosion around the foundation, leading to further settling or shifting. By repairing leaks promptly, homeowners can prevent costly repairs to the structure and avoid issues like basement flooding, musty odors, or compromised wall stability. Foundation leak repair helps maintain the safety and durability of the entire property.
Properties that typically require foundation leak repair services include residential homes, especially those with basements or crawl spaces, as well as multi-family buildings and small commercial structures. Older homes are often more vulnerable due to aging materials and outdated drainage systems. Properties situated on slopes or in areas with high water tables are also at increased risk of water infiltration through the foundation. The overview below groups typical Foundation Leak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Smyrna,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or foundation leak repairs in Smyrna, GA often range from $250-$600. Many routine fixes, such as sealing small cracks or patching minor leaks, fall within this band.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this range, which usually involves additional materials or labor.
Moderate Fixes - For more involved repairs like replacing sections of damaged foundation or installing new waterproofing systems, local contractors generally charge between $1,000-$3,000. Most projects in this category land in the middle of this range, with some larger or more complex jobs approaching the upper limit.
Extensive Repairs - Large-scale repairs, including significant foundation stabilization or extensive waterproofing, often cost between $3,500-$7,000. These projects are less common and typically involve multiple days of work and substantial materials.
Full Foundation Replacement - Complete foundation replacement or major structural overhauls can exceed $10,000, with many projects falling in the $12,000-$20,000 range. Such jobs are relatively rare and usually involve comprehensive planning and significant excavation work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a foundation leak? Signs include damp or cracked basement walls, unexplained water stains, mold growth, and a sudden increase in indoor humidity levels.
How do local contractors typically repair foundation leaks? They often use methods such as sealing cracks, installing waterproof barriers, or applying exterior drainage solutions to prevent water intrusion.
Can foundation leaks cause structural damage? Yes, persistent leaks can weaken the foundation over time, potentially leading to cracks, shifting, or other structural issues.
